Конвертируйте JPX в PowerPoint с помощью GroupDocs.Conversion для .NET: пошаговое руководство

В сегодняшнюю цифровую эпоху преобразование файлов изображений в форматы презентаций имеет важное значение для подготовки визуального контента для встреч или конференций. Это руководство проведет вас через процесс использования GroupDocs.Conversion для .NET для бесшовного преобразования файлов изображений JPEG 2000 (.jpx) в презентации PowerPoint (PPT).

Что вы узнаете

  • Понимание GroupDocs.Conversion для .NET: Узнайте, как эта мощная библиотека может упростить ваши задачи по конвертации документов.
  • Настройка вашей среды: Изучите предварительные условия и шаги установки, необходимые перед началом конвертации файлов.
  • Загрузка файлов JPX: Узнайте, как загрузить файл изображения JPEG 2000 с помощью C#.
  • Настройка параметров конвертации: Узнайте, как настроить параметры для преобразования документов в формат PPT.
  • Конвертация JPX в PPTСледуйте этому пошаговому руководству по преобразованию файлов .jpx в презентации PowerPoint.

Давайте разберемся, начав с предварительных условий, которые вам понадобятся для подготовки вашей среды.

Предпосылки

Чтобы следовать этому руководству, убедитесь, что у вас есть:

  1. Необходимые библиотеки и зависимости:

    • GroupDocs.Conversion для .NET (версия 25.3.0 или более поздняя)
  2. Требования к настройке среды:

    • Среда разработки, поддерживающая .NET Framework или .NET Core.
    • Visual Studio или любая предпочитаемая вами IDE, поддерживающая C#.
  3. Необходимые знания:

    • Базовые знания программирования на C# и .NET.
    • Знакомство с обработкой файлов в приложениях .NET.

Настройка GroupDocs.Conversion для .NET

Прежде чем начать процесс конвертации, вам нужно настроить свой проект с GroupDocs.Conversion для .NET. Эту библиотеку можно легко добавить в ваш проект через NuGet или .NET CLI.

Этапы установки:

Консоль диспетчера пакетов N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

После установки библиотеки вам необходимо приобрести лицензию для полной функциональности. Вы можете получить временную бесплатную пробную версию или купить подписку:

  • Бесплатная пробная версия: Получите доступ к ограниченным функциям бесплатно.
  • Временная лицензия: Доступно на их веб-сайте; временно разрешено неограниченное использование.
  • Покупка: Для постоянного доступа и поддержки.

Базовая инициализация и настройка

Вот как начать работу с GroupDocs.Conversion в вашем приложении C#: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Убедитесь, что лицензия у вас есть.
        // new License().SetLicense("Путь к вашему файлу лицензии");

        Console.WriteLine("GroupDocs.Conversion setup complete.");
    }
}

Эта простая настройка инициализирует среду и подготавливает вас к выполнению преобразований документов.

Руководство по внедрению

Процесс конвертации включает несколько ключевых шагов, каждый из которых способствует успешному преобразованию файлов JPX в презентации PowerPoint. Давайте разберем эти шаги по функциям.

Загрузить файл JPX

Обзор

Загрузка исходного файла — первый шаг в любой задаче конвертации. В этом разделе объясняется, как можно использовать GroupDocs.Conversion для загрузки файлов изображений JPEG 2000 (.jpx).

Шаг 1: Определите путь к каталогу ваших документов

Перед загрузкой файла укажите каталог, в котором хранятся ваши файлы JPX.

string documentDirectory = "YOUR_DOCUMENT_DIRECTORY";
string inputFilePath = System.IO.Path.Combine(documentDirectory, "sample.jpx");

Заменять "YOUR_DOCUMENT_DIRECTORY" с фактическим путем и sample.jpx с вашим конкретным именем файла.

Шаг 2: Загрузите исходный файл JPX

Используя GroupDocs.Conversion, вы можете загрузить файл для конвертации, как показано ниже:

using (var converter = new Converter(inputFilePath))
{
    // Объект-конвертер теперь инициализирован.
}

The Converter класс облегчает загрузку и конвертацию документов. Он подготавливает ваш файл для последующих этапов конвертации.

Настройте параметры преобразования презентации

Обзор

Далее необходимо настроить параметры конвертации загруженного документа в формат презентации PowerPoint.

Шаг 1: Создание экземпляра PresentationConvertOptions

Настройте параметры, необходимые для преобразования, используя PresentationConvertOptions.

using GroupDocs.Conversion.Options.Convert;

var options = new PresentationConvertOptions
{
    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Ppt // Установите выходной формат PPT.
};

Эта конфигурация указывает, что целевым файлом будет презентация PowerPoint.

Конвертировать JPX в PPT

Обзор

Наконец, вы преобразуете свой файл JPX в презентацию PowerPoint, используя настроенные параметры.

Шаг 1: Определите путь к выходному каталогу

Решите, где вы хотите сохранить преобразованные файлы:

string outputDirectory = "Y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putDirectory, "jpx-converted-to.ppt");

Заменять "YOUR_OUTPUT_DIRECTORY" с предполагаемым путем к каталогу.

Шаг 2: Загрузите и преобразуйте файл JPX в формат PPT.

Выполните преобразование, повторно используя converter объект и применение параметров преобразования:

using (var converter = new Converter(inputFilePath))
{
    converter.Convert(outputFile, options);
}

Выходной файл PPT будет сохранен в указанном вами каталоге.

Практические применения

GroupDocs.Conversion предлагает универсальные решения для многих реальных сценариев. Вот несколько вариантов использования, где преобразование JPX в PPT может быть полезным:

  1. Образовательные презентации: Преобразование высококачественных изображений в слайд-шоу для использования в классе.
  2. Деловые встречи: Преобразуйте визуальные данные в презентации для заинтересованных сторон.
  3. Маркетинговые материалыСоздавайте привлекательные файлы PowerPoint из рекламных изображений.

Эти примеры иллюстрируют возможности интеграции с другими системами .NET, расширяя возможности обработки документов вашего приложения.

Соображения производительности

Оптимизация производительности имеет решающее значение при обработке конверсий. Вот несколько советов:

  • Управление ресурсами: Обеспечьте правильную утилизацию объектов с помощью using заявления для эффективного управления ресурсами.
  • Использование памяти: Контролируйте потребление памяти во время пакетной обработки, чтобы предотвратить перегрузку.
  • Лучшие практики: Следуйте рекомендациям .NET для эффективного управления памятью, особенно в крупномасштабных приложениях.

Заключение

В этом уроке вы узнали, как конвертировать файлы JPX в презентации PowerPoint с помощью GroupDocs.Conversion для .NET. Выполнив шаги, описанные выше, вы сможете интегрировать мощные возможности конвертации документов в свои проекты .NET.

Далее, рассмотрите возможность изучения других форматов файлов, поддерживаемых GroupDocs.Conversion, и экспериментируйте с различными конфигурациями. Если у вас есть вопросы или вам нужна поддержка, не стесняйтесь обращаться через форумы сообщества.

Раздел часто задаваемых вопросов

  1. Что такое GroupDocs.Conversion для .NET?
    • Библиотека, облегчающая преобразование различных типов документов в приложениях .NET.
  2. Могу ли я конвертировать другие форматы файлов с помощью GroupDocs.Conversion?
    • Да, он поддерживает широкий спектр форматов файлов, помимо преобразования JPX в PPT.
  3. Что делать, если конвертация не удалась?
    • Проверьте наличие распространенных проблем, таких как неправильные пути к файлам или неподдерживаемые форматы.
  4. Есть ли ограничение на количество файлов, которые я могу конвертировать?
    • Конкретных ограничений нет, но при обработке больших партий следует учитывать влияние на производительность.
  5. Как мне управлять лицензированием с помощью GroupDocs.Conversion?
    • Получите временную лицензию для доступа к полному функционалу или приобретите подписку для долгосрочного использования.

Ресурсы